pub enum InvalidUWD {
OuterPortType {
port_name: NameSegment,
},
InnerPortType {
box_name: NameSegment,
port_name: NameSegment,
},
}Expand description
A failure of a UWD to be valid/well-typed.
Variants§
OuterPortType
Outer port is not assigned or assigned to a junction with wrong type.
Fields
§
port_name: NameSegmentName of the offending port.
InnerPortType
Port of box is not assigned or assigned to a junction with wrong type.
Fields
§
box_name: NameSegmentName of the box containing the offending port.
§
port_name: NameSegmentName of the offending port.
